Safety Tips for Using Scissor Lifts
When operating scissor lifts in California, always follow these essential safety guidelines:
- Pre-Operation Inspection: Always inspect the scissor lift before use, checking for hydraulic leaks, damaged controls, or structural issues
- Weight Limitations: Never exceed the manufacturer's specified weight capacity, including all personnel, tools, and materials
- Platform Maintenance: Keep the platform clean and free of debris, oil, or other slip hazards
- Overhead Awareness: Be aware of overhead obstructions including power lines, ceiling fixtures, and building structures
- Level Operation: Only operate on level surfaces unless using a rough terrain model specifically designed for uneven ground
- Proper Training: Ensure all operators have received proper training and certification for scissor lift operation
- Weather Considerations: Avoid outdoor operation during high winds, storms, or extreme weather conditions
- Manufacturer Guidelines: Follow all manufacturer guidelines and safety protocols specific to your equipment model
